http://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=13853 ------- Comment #7 from eich@pdx.freedesktop.org 2007-12-29 09:45 PST ------- You should be able to do something like git-checkout master@{"13 days ago"}. This depends slightly on the version of your git. On older versions you needed to create a branch (git-checkout -b testbranch master@{"13 days ago"). -- Configure bugmail: http://bugs.freedesktop.org/userprefs.cgi?tab=email ------- You are receiving this mail because: ------- You are the QA contact for the bug, or are watching the QA contact. _______________________________________________ xorg-team mailing list xorg-team@lists.x.org http://lists.x.org/mailman/listinfo/xorg-team -- To unsubscribe, e-mail: radeonhd+unsubscribe@opensuse.org For additional commands, e-mail: radeonhd+help@opensuse.org
